Starting point is 00:13:48 And I have just noticed that my teeth have gone. All fools in life have one thing in common, according to the Stoics. Seneca says what they all have in common is that they're always getting ready to start. They are delaying to live because they think they have. the future they think they have forever. They say, I'm not ready, or they say, I'm going to do it after, I'm going to do it once this thing happens, when conditions are more favorable. They never say to themselves, I'm never going to do it. They say I'm going to do it later. No one knows what the future holds. Life is happening right now the second. In fact, the time that ticks by the
Starting point is 00:14:23 Stoics say belongs to death. It's dead. It can never be recovered. So don't be a fool. Don't delay could be good today Marcus Reelis reminds us instead you choose tomorrow if it's important to you stay with it keep on cultivating it slowly slowly but give yourself some time but if you really want something I think this is the way slowly steadily wholeheartedly wholeheartedly Meaning what? And though we might want our goals and accomplishments to arrive immediately, maybe a smarter strategy is to stretch out the achievements of our dreams. We shouldn't wish for overnight success, as we would then need to be able to beat it pretty soon, lest we feel like we're declining. Instead, slow, consistent progress is a more reliable way to maintain satisfaction. Purposely aiming for slow success strategy may actually ensure that you always feel like you're going in the right direction. Loneliness is the price of ambition. Pleasure is the price of discipline.
